Has there ever been a time when you didn’t feel like yourself? Maybe somebody did or said something to you and you overreacted in a way that left you feeling embarrassed or confused? Well, today we’re going to examine experiences like this through the lens of what Swiss psychotherapist, Carl Jung, called the shadow. You’re listening to Psychedelic Therapy Frontiers–the podcast devoted to exploring the frontiers of psychedelic medicine and what it takes to cultivate a healthy mind, body, and spirit. Psychedelic Therapy Frontiers is brought to you by Numinus and is hosted by Dr. Steve Thayer and Dr. Reid Robison. In addition to explaining what the personal shadow is, Reid and Steve explore the function of the shadow, how shadow content reveals itself to the conscious mind, methods of doing shadow work, the importance of self-compassion and acceptance when doing this work, how psychedelics are used in shadow work, and much more.
